Born Inayah Lamis in Houston, Texas on November 8, 1989, the R&B and soul singer-songwriter who is best known by her first name. She became interested in music as a toddler and was writing songs by the age of 10. After working for a jingle company, she began her solo career in 2017 when she released a cover of Ella Maiâs âBooâd Up,â which became a viral sensation on social media thanks to celebrities sharing it on their social media accounts. She followed up that popular cover version with original material including her breakthrough hit, âFairy Taleâ (2018). Following several more hit singles in 2019 â âN.A.S.,â âSuga Daddy,â âReal Love,â and the enormously successful âBest Thingâ â she released her debut album, S.O.L.A.R. After issuing the singles â âGo Get That Bâ (2020), âFallinââ (2021), and âWhat Are We?â â she released the EPs Side A (2021) and Insecure (2022). In 2024, Inayah released her sophomore full length album, Wait, Thereâs More, which included the singles âFor the Streetsâ and âHot Sauce.â
